ODI SX Team Line-Up
Joining the ODI family of riders for 2012 are two new premier teams. As a new team to the circuit, L and MC Racing has enlisted rider Andrew Short to pilot their Honda machines. The bike that Andrew will ride is a factory Honda, with only a few different parts, including ODI grips. After testing ODI, Andrew was impressed with the quality and the performance.
“I really like these grips,” Andrew said. “And that’s saying a lot because I’m really particular about my grips”. Andrew will be a key player in the advancement and development of the ODI product line who has always shown a large amount of support for athletes in both bicycling and motocross.
Additionally, after working with Allan Brown during the 2011 season while he was at Star Racing, ODI will be the exclusive grips used by Team Motosport.com / TiLube / Foremost Ins. Team Motosport.com has recently signed riders Nick Wey and Chris Blose for 2012.
“We are really excited about the 2012 season heading into A1,” Powersports Brand Manager Kevin Stevens said. “Adding riders like Short and Wey to our team just goes to show you that our products can be put the test at the highest level of our sports and pass with flying colors. We’re glad to have Chris back on ODI and our odds for some podiums this year are looking great with these riders in both classes.”

About ODI:
ODI dates back to the 1980’s as one of the leaders in grip manufacturing. Focusing primarily on the bmx and mountain bike industries through the 90’s and early 2000’s ODI re-entered the motocross scene when they developed the patented lock-on grip system that eliminates wire and glue. Continuing to advance the way riders hold on to their bikes, ODI has worked closely with the teams they support such as Troy Lee Designs to create the product that is now being used by some of the top teams in the industry.
